- The distance between Red Lodge, Mt, Usa and Warrenton, Mo, Usa is approximately 1,651 km or 1,026 mi.
- To reach Red Lodge, Mt in this distance one would set out from Warrenton, Mo bearing 300.5°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Red Lodge, Mt bearing 288.2° or WNW .
- Red Lodge, Mt has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Warrenton, Mo has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Red Lodge, Mt is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Warrenton, Mo is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 6 °C (10.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.3 °C (7.7°F) less in Red Lodge, Mt.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 314.4 mm (12.4 in) less which is equivalent to 314.4 l/m² (7.72 US gal/ft²) or 3,144,000 l/ha (336,114 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.2° lower in Red Lodge, Mt than in Warrenton, Mo.
